Job Description

Role Summary

The MTS is a senior technical contributor who drives wet process development through complex experimentation, material/chemical characterization, and integration fixing, while helping establish process technology roadmaps and delivering silicon‑based solutions for future memory needs. Acts as a key contributor expected to deliver measurable results and mentor early‑career engineers aligned to technical leadership expectations.

Main Responsibilities

  • Lead project‑level initiatives focused on development of wet processes.

  • Carry out complex experiments and support process integration under guidance of senior staff members.

  • Facilitate technology transfer and assist in ramp‑up maintain accurate records and prepare technical reports.

  • Mentor early‑career staff participate in multi‑functional problem solving drive continuous improvement and optimization.

  • Contribute to documentation of guidelines/SOPs and knowledge management stay current on emerging technologies and wet processing advancements.

Candidate Profile

Minimum Qualifications / Experience

  • PhD ≥8 yrs, or Master's ≥11 yrs, or Bachelor's ≥13 yrs of relevant experience in
    Electrical Engineering, Materials Science, Chemical Engineering, Physics, or related field,

  • Deep understanding of vapor etch, wet strip, dry strip, selective chemical etching experience fixing process issues and supporting transfer R&D → manufacturing.

Musthave Technical Skills

  • Possess a deep understanding of the process technologies such as Vapor etch, wet strip, dry strip, selective chemical etching, etc.

  • Familiarity with electrical evaluation methods and fab metrology tools (e.g., CD‑SEM, thickness measurement, particle counters).

  • DOE / SPC and data analysis systems (e.g., Y3) to analyze experimental outcomes.

  • Working knowledge of memory process flow (planar + vertical NAND context).

Musthave Soft Skills

  • Cross‑functional collaboration, concise communication, and ability to prioritize in a dynamic environment.

Highly Preferable

  • Strong record of technical contributions, publications, or patents in relevant domains
